Differences
Reasons to consider the Intel Core i7-9700K
- CPU is newer: launch date 1 year(s) 9 month(s) later
- Processor is unlocked, an unlocked multiplier allows for easier overclocking
- 4 more cores, run more applications at once: 8 vs 4
- 4 more threads: 8 vs 4
- Around 40% higher clock speed: 4.90 GHz vs 3.50 GHz
- 2x more L1 cache, more data can be stored in the L1 cache for quick access later
- 2x more L2 cache, more data can be stored in the L2 cache for quick access later
- 2x more L3 cache, more data can be stored in the L3 cache for quick access later
- 2x more maximum memory size: 128 GB vs 64 GB
- Around 38% better performance in PassMark - Single thread mark: 2868 vs 2078
- 2.6x better performance in PassMark - CPU mark: 14424 vs 5477
- Around 48% better performance in Geekbench 4 - Single Core: 1306 vs 881
- 2.7x better performance in Geekbench 4 - Multi-Core: 7386 vs 2786
- 2.8x better performance in 3DMark Fire Strike - Physics Score: 5855 vs 2078
- 2.6x better performance in CompuBench 1.5 Desktop - Face Detection (mPixels/s): 9.136 vs 3.523
- 2.6x better performance in CompuBench 1.5 Desktop - Ocean Surface Simulation (Frames/s): 195.695 vs 74.155
- 2.5x better performance in CompuBench 1.5 Desktop - T-Rex (Frames/s): 1.105 vs 0.441
- 2.5x better performance in CompuBench 1.5 Desktop - Video Composition (Frames/s): 5.449 vs 2.201
- 2.7x better performance in CompuBench 1.5 Desktop - Bitcoin Mining (mHash/s): 15.67 vs 5.905
- Around 26% better performance in GFXBench 4.0 - Car Chase Offscreen (Frames): 2156 vs 1706
- Around 26% better performance in GFXBench 4.0 - Car Chase Offscreen (Fps): 2156 vs 1706

Reasons to consider the Intel Core i5-7400
- Around 46% lower typical power consumption: 65 Watt vs 95 Watt
- 2.7x better performance in GFXBench 4.0 - Manhattan (Frames): 3128 vs 1155
- 2.8x better performance in GFXBench 4.0 - T-Rex (Frames): 5712 vs 2066
- 2.7x better performance in GFXBench 4.0 - Manhattan (Fps): 3128 vs 1155
- 2.8x better performance in GFXBench 4.0 - T-Rex (Fps): 5712 vs 2066
